Actions

Dec 18, 2025 · Senate

Received in the Senate.

Dec 17, 2025 · House floor actions

Rules Committee Resolution H. Res. 953 Reported to House. Rule provides for consideration of H.R. 6703, H.R. 498 and H.R. 3492. The resolution provides for consideration of H.R. 6703 and H.R. 498 under a closed rule and H.R. 3492 under a structured rule with one hour of general debate and one motion to recommit on each bill.

Dec 17, 2025 · House floor actions

Considered under the provisions of rule H. Res. 953. (consideration: CR H5956-5977)

Dec 17, 2025 · House floor actions

Rule provides for consideration of H.R. 6703, H.R. 498 and H.R. 3492. The resolution provides for consideration of H.R. 6703 and H.R. 498 under a closed rule and H.R. 3492 under a structured rule with one hour of general debate and one motion to recommit on each bill.

Dec 17, 2025 · House floor actions

DEBATE - The House proceeded with one hour of debate on H.R. 6703.

Dec 17, 2025 · House floor actions

The previous question was ordered pursuant to the rule.

Dec 17, 2025 · House floor actions

Ms. Underwood moved to recommit to the Committee on Energy and Commerce. (text: CR H5977)

Dec 17, 2025 · House floor actions

The previous question on the motion to recommit was ordered pursuant to clause 2(b) of rule XIX.

Dec 17, 2025 · House floor actions

POSTPONED PROCEEDINGS - At the conclusion of debate on H.R. 6703, the Chair put the question on motion to recommit and by voice vote, announced the noes had prevailed. Ms. Underwood demanded the yeas and nays and the Chair postponed further proceedings until a time to be announced.

Dec 17, 2025 · House floor actions

Considered as unfinished business. (consideration: CR H6006-6008)

Dec 17, 2025 · House floor actions

On motion to recommit Failed by the Yeas and Nays: 210 - 218 (Roll no. 348).

Dec 17, 2025 · Library of Congress

Passed/agreed to in House: On passage Passed by the Yeas and Nays: 216 - 211 (Roll no. 349).

Dec 17, 2025 · House floor actions

On passage Passed by the Yeas and Nays: 216 - 211 (Roll no. 349). (text: CR H5956-5966)

Dec 17, 2025 · House floor actions

Motion to reconsider laid on the table Agreed to without objection.

Dec 15, 2025 · Library of Congress

Introduced in House

Dec 15, 2025 · Library of Congress

Introduced in House

Dec 15, 2025 · House floor actions

Referred to the Committee on Energy and Commerce, and in addition to the Committees on Education and Workforce, and Ways and Means, for a period to be subsequently determined by the Speaker, in each case for consideration of such provisions as fall within the jurisdiction of the committee concerned.
